Archivi giornalieri: 4 febbraio 2008

[Sicurezza] [Sicurezza] 10 Tip sulla protezione del codice per lo sviluppatore

Mi sono imbattuto, quasi per caso, in un articolo interessante sulla protezione del codice che ogni sviluppatore dovrebbe conoscere:

http://msdn.microsoft.com/msdnmag/issues/02/09/securitytips/default.aspx?loc=it

Sono 10 suggerimenti che dovremmo imporci di applicare, ma molto spesso per pigrizia o per scarsa conoscenza dell’argomento non applichiamo.

[VSTO] creazione di un task panel tramite VB.NET e C#

Sul blog di Emanuele Mattei è stato pubblicato un articolo sulla gestione di un task panel in Office: http://blog.shareoffice.it/emanuele/articles/9240.aspx.

Anche in questo caso, la tecnologia trattata è VSTO, cioè Visual Studio Tools for Office che ora, nella nuova versione di Visual Studio 2008 (in particolare nella versione Professional), è incluso del prodotto stesso e non è più necessario installarlo come add-in separato.

[VSTO] Creare uno Smart Tag in Word

Sul sito www.iprogrammatori.it è stato pubblicato un articolo che spiega la procedura per creare uno smart tag in Word, utilizzando Visual Tools for Office (VSTO).

Articolo completo QUI. Nella pagina è possibile anche trovare un link per scaricare l’esempio.

[Excel 2007] Patch per bug nei calcoli

Il 26 Settembre 2007, Punto Informatico aveva segnalato un bug nei calcoli di Excel 2007: http://punto-informatico.it/p.aspx?id=2073462

In particolare risultano errati questi calcoli che dovrebbero fornire in tutti i casi 65535, mentre invece forniscono 100000:
=5,1*12850
=10,2*6425
=20,4*3212,5
=40,8*1606,25
=850*77,1
=77,1*850
=154,2*425
=212,5*308,4
=308,4*212,5
=425*154,2

Microsoft ha fornito la spiegazione ufficiale dell’errore, attribuendolo ad un errore di visualizzazione e non di calcolo. Infatti è sufficiente aggiungere alla formula di cui sopra -1 oppure +2 e otterremo il risultato corretto:
http://blogs.msdn.com/excel/archive/2007/09/25/calculation-issue-update.aspx

Errore di calcolo o errore di visualizzazione, la cosa comunque è estremamente inquietante, tanto che Microsoft ha anticipato una patch per risolvere il problema, come indicato nel nuovo articolo di Punto Informatico:
http://punto-informatico.it/p.aspx?id=2085908

Ecco quindi la patch, scaricabile da: http://blogs.msdn.com/excel/archive/2007/10/09/calculation-issue-update-fix-available.aspx e che dovrebbe essere inclusa nel Service Pack di Office 2007 e tra gli aggiornamenti di Windows Update.

[C#] Rilevare inserimento/rimozione di dischi removibili USB

Un nuovo interessante articolo su CodeProject: come rilevare l’inserimento e la rimozione di dischi removibili.

Corredato da un progetto in linguaggio C#.

Iscriviti

Ricevi al tuo indirizzo email tutti i nuovi post del sito.

Unisciti agli altri 846 follower